Abstract
231,176. Sanguineti, E. March 18, 1925. Converting rotary into oscillating motion; conveying reciprocating motion. - Rotary motion alternately in opposite directions is obtained from reciprocating motion of a non-rotary sleeve or nut which engages a cylindrical member formed with a steeply-pitched screw thread or threads. In the arrangement shown in Fig. 1, the cylindrical member 1 is rotatably mounted in a frame 5 pivoted at 9, and transmits motion through geans 10, 11 to a shaft 12, being externally threaded and rotated alternately in opposite directions by a sleeve or nut 3 carried by a frame 6 slidably mounted in the frame 5 and connected at its outer end 8 to a crank 7 which rotates in the direction of the arrow 15. In the arrangement shown in Fig. 2, a pair of steeplythreaded cylinders 1 transmit motion through toothed gears 17, 18 to a shaft 19, being rotated alternately in opposite directions by engagement with nuts carried by a crosshead 3 on a reciprocatory rod 16.
